Askot Project

IRL holds a strategic 15% shareholding in Pebble Creek Mining Limited (TSX-V: PEB), which owns 100% of the Askot Project through a subsidiary Adi Gold Mining Pvt Ltd. 

Pebble Creek is a Canadian-based minerals exploration company listed on the TSX Venture Exchange (TSX-V: PEB) with its primary project, the Askot base metal project, located in the Uttarakhand state, northern India. Further information on Pebble Creek is available at www.pebcreek.com.

The Askot project lies on a granted Prospecting Licence, and the Mining Lease application has been approved by State and Central Governments.  The Mining plan has also been approved and environmental clearance given.   

Geology and Resources

The Askot project is a polymetallic volcanogenic massive sulphide (VMS) deposit containing 5 metals of economic significance: gold, silver, copper, lead and zinc.  The full extent of the mineralised system has not been defined and there is further anomalism over a wide area.  The lens discovered to date has been defined for 800m and is open along strike and down dip.  Geochemical anomalies extend for 3000m along strike. 

 

In August 2008, SRK Consulting, the worldwide geology and engineering consultancy, estimated an NI43-101 (and JORC) compatible resource for the Askot Project of 2.0 million tonnes at 2.6% Cu, 5.7% Zn, 3.7% Pb, 0.5 g/t Au and 37 g/t Ag at a net smelter revenue cut off of $US100 per tonne.  This included 1.86 million tonnes in the Indicated category with 0.15 million tonnes in the Inferred category. The cut off grade estimation contained assumptions on metal recovery from metallurgical tests and conservative long term metal prices:

 

NSR Calculation Assumptions  

Metal

Metallurgical

recovery

Metal price

(US$)

Copper

85%

$2.00   pound

Lead

78%

$0.65   pound

Zinc

77%

$0.90   pound

Silver

60%

$15.00 ounce

Gold

60%

$900    ounce

The average grade of the resource, in terms of NSR is $US250 per tonne of ore, or in terms of “copper equivalent”, using the recoveries and prices above - 6.6% Cu.  Full details of the resource can be found in announcements by Pebble Creek.
